Padmaavat earns Rs. 239 crores at BO

| @indiablooms | Feb 11, 2018, at 12:37 am

Mumbai, Feb 10 (IBNS): Actress Deepika Padukone's latest released movie Padmaavat has earned Rs.  239 crores at the Box Office till Friday.

"#Padmaavat remains STEADY... Biz should grow on Sat and Sun... [Week 3] Fri 3.50 cr. Total: ₹ 239.50 cr. India biz," film critic Taran Adarsh tweeted,

The movie is directed by Sanjay Leela Bhansali.

It was the first major release of the year.

Deepika is playing the role of of Padmavati.

Shahid Kapoor and Ranveer Singh have earned appreciations from fans for their performances in the movie.
